Parsons and the Cowboys' front office are still in the midst of contract extension negotiations for a deal that CowboysCountry.com reported could be in the neighborhood of $200 million ... or $40 million a year.
That contract will put Parsons on one of the richest non-quarterback deals in NFL history ... but as you can see, he doesn't seem to be stressing too much about it right now.
